Scan barcode
678 pages • first pub 2003 (editions)
ISBN/UID: 9781578594016
Format: Paperback
Language: English
Publisher: Visible Ink Press
Publication date: 26 September 2012
678 pages • first pub 2003 (editions)
ISBN/UID: 9781578594016
Format: Paperback
Language: English
Publisher: Visible Ink Press
Publication date: 26 September 2012
615 pages • first pub 2003 (editions)
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 01 August 2003
615 pages • first pub 2003 (editions)
ISBN/UID: None
Format: Paperback
Language: English
Publisher: Not specified
Publication date: 01 August 2003